Episodic structure (not really causal or strict type of structure), more like episodes where it happens over a longer period of time. Jacobean era we see the secularizaiton, and commercialization of theatre. There were theatres built and pro theatre companies. Each crime in the play are motivated by good and bad intentions. John webster (c. 1580 c. 1634) had a reputation of writing dark and violent plays. The duchess of malfi (first performed 1613-1614, by the king"s men) Combines some of the genres of revenge tragedy, romantic tragedy,
